Mothers Day Blues

I have been commissioned to make a few Mothers Day cards for people at work so I thought I would play around with some ideas.
This card is using the new range of Parisienne Blue from Do Crafts..... The whole range has a very french feel to it. I think this will be very popular. The stamped little bottle tops have been created using the Madam Payraud typewriter stamps and a medium circle punch.......
When you punch out the circles and then just emboss the edge it looks like a little bottle top - very cute!
I can see me using this technique for lots of things like names etc for mens cards.
 The purple background has been created with the new Do Crafts spritzing ink.

Paint sample strips

Today I wanted to show you 3 cards that I made with some of the paint sample strips that I have.
You know the ones - you are looking to chose a colour of paint so you get the free sample strip with lots of shades of the same colour on them..... well this is what I made with them......


Nice clean and simple cards, but they are great fun to make and really quick and easy.
Perfect for that crafting in a hurry and you always know the colours will work together!!!
